Popular Tree Trimming Techniques That You Ought to Understand
Tree trimming uses various techniques tailored to promote vigorous development and visual attractiveness. One popular technique is crown thinning, which involves selectively removing branches to improve light penetration and air circulation within the tree. This technique enhances overall health while maintaining the tree's natural shape. Another common approach is crown reduction, used to decrease the height of a tree while keeping its structure. This is particularly beneficial for trees that threaten nearby structures. Additionally, the technique of deadwooding focuses on cutting dead or diseased branches, preventing the spread of pests and diseases. Finally, directional pruning encourages growth in specific directions, allowing for better landscape design and preventing obstructions. Understanding these techniques enables property owners to make informed decisions about their tree care, ensuring a healthier and more visually appealing landscape.

Common Inquired Questions
How frequently Should I arrange Tree Trimming Services?
Tree trimming services should typically be arranged every 1 to 3 years, based on the tree species, growth rate, and local weather patterns. Regular evaluations can assist in maintain tree health and prevent potential hazards.
What Is the Optimal Season for Tree Trimming?
The finest season for tree pruning is late winter extending into early spring, before new foliage begins. This timing limits pressure on the plants and allows for better mending, promoting vigorous and healthy growth that is more robust subsequently.
Can Tree Trimming Negatively impact My Trees?
Tree cutting can injure trees if performed incorrectly or excessively, causing stress, disease, or structural problems. However, when carried out properly and at optimal periods, it fosters health and longevity in trees. Proper techniques are vital.

What Is the Typical Cost of Expert Tree Trimming?
Professional tree trimming typically ranges between $200 and $1,500, influenced by such factors as tree size, location, and intricacy of the corresponding information work. Additional expenses may be applicable for specialized services or emergency requests.
